【文件属性】:
文件名称:aiochrome:适用于Google Chrome开发协议的Python程序包[asyncio基础]
文件大小:621KB
文件格式:ZIP
更新时间:2021-02-01 03:07:20
python chrome chrome-devtools chrome-debugging-protocol headless
碘Chrome
适用于Google Chrome开发者协议的Python软件包,
目录
安装
要安装aiochrome,只需:
$ pip install -U aiochrome
或从GitHub:
$ pip install -U git+https://github.com/fate0/aiochrome.git
或从来源:
$ python setup.py install
设定Chrome
只是:
$ google-chrome --remote-debugging-port=9222
或无头模式(Chrome版本> = 59):
$ google-chrome --headless --disable-gpu --remote-debugging-port=9222
或使用docker:
$ docker pull fate0/headless-chrome
$ docker run -it --rm --cap-add=SYS_ADMIN -p9222:9222 fate0/headless-chrome
入门
import asyncio
import
【文件预览】:
aiochrome-master
----MANIFEST.in(163B)
----aiochrome()
--------exceptions.py(421B)
--------__init__.py(124B)
--------tab.py(7KB)
--------browser.py(2KB)
--------cli.py(3KB)
----requirements.txt(30B)
----examples()
--------multi_tabs_screenshot.py(2KB)
--------multi_tabs_navigate.py(3KB)
--------multi_tabs_pdf.py(2KB)
--------demo1.py(902B)
--------demo2.py(674B)
----.travis.yml(449B)
----mkdocs.yml(104B)
----tox.ini(247B)
----LICENSE(11KB)
----requirements_dev.txt(80B)
----setup.cfg(27B)
----setup.py(1KB)
----README.md(4KB)
----docs()
--------index.md(4KB)
--------images()
--------api()
----tests()
--------__init__.py(0B)
--------test_browser.py(2KB)
--------test_multi_tabs.py(2KB)
--------test_single_tab.py(8KB)
----.gitignore(800B)
----.coveragerc(428B)